**Q: The Levyglass tax-rate cache went stale and won't refresh — what now?**

A: Normal flow: the cache self-invalidates hourly. If it's wedged, restart the refresh worker. If the worker refuses to authenticate after restart, use the recovery console. New folks: don't guess credentials. Enter the recovery passphrase listed just below this entry.

recovery phrase for tagug-yagug: lamox-gilax-keleth-gilath

## Document Transport: Uniform Paperwork, Navis Point Depot

Uniform contracts and sizing records for the new Navis Point depot move by courier only. No internal mail. Originals stay with the office manager until collection; copies go to HR. Use the sealed blue wallet, log the wallet number, and get a signature both ends. Same-day service through Kestwick Couriers. No exceptions without sign-off from operations. At hand-over, tell the courier exactly this:

dispatch memo: the eliath belael courier leaves the praox ledger at gate 8841 under passcode 017589

[ ] Autocomplete index latency — security review. The Quillseek suggest index rebuild now runs in a sandboxed worker after the permission-bleed finding in the Varden audit. Confirm the rebuild job drops filesystem access outside its scratch dir, that query logs feeding the index are scrubbed of session material, and that the slow-path fallback cannot be forced by crafted prefixes. P95 is back under 120ms on staging. Sign-off should reference the candidate build noted below.

trace token, kahog-tajeg: htk6_97d963

Hey all,

The new undo/redo stack in Sketchloom shipped to 100% of users last night. Quick recap: we swapped the old snapshot-per-action model for command-based history, so memory use on big diagrams dropped hard and redo finally survives a reconnect. One hiccup with grouped shapes got patched before rollout finished. History depth and persistence knobs are now server-controlled, not hardcoded.

For the sync, here's the exact configuration the history service is currently running.

service settings:
PRAIX_LOG_LEVEL=error
PRAIX_METRICS_HOST=metrics.praix.qorvelcorp.corp
PRAIX_POOL_SIZE=16